Good Afternoon, Earlier today, August 8, 2012, writs of election were issued for by-elections to be held in the Electoral Districts of Kitchener-Waterloo and Vaughan. The by-elections will be held on Thursday, September 6, 2012. The Returning Officer for the by-election in Kitchener-Waterloo is Richard Findlay. His office is located at:<br> 230 Regina Street North, Unit 1<br> Waterloo, ON N2J 3B5 The Returning Officer for the by-election in Vaughan is Al Ruggero. His office is located at:<br> 4800 Highway 7, Unit 1,<br> Woodbridge, ON L4L 1H8 Please note that telephone lines have not as yet been installed and we will provide those numbers as soon as we can. They will be posted to the website when available. Please visit www.wemakevotingeasy.ca These offices will be open to the public seven days a week, from 10 a.m. to 8 p.m. Monday to Saturday, and 12 p.m. to 5 p.m. Sundays (except during the advance poll period when they will be open from 10 a.m. to 8 p.m.) The Elections Ontario website will have a section dedicated to information for candidates, political parties and constituency associations. All of the appropriate information is being prepared and will be posted no later than tomorrow. Candidates’ Calendar: I have attached to this email an English and French copy of the candidates’ calendar for the by-elections. The calendar will also appear on our website. Forms (including Nomination and Registration forms) will be made available on the website. I would also like to highlight some of the key dates for the by-election, including: Nominations - *open on: Thursday, August 16, 2012 and *close on: Thursday, August 23, 2012 at 2:00 p.m. Candidate Endorsement: No later than Thursday, August 23, 2012 at 2:00 p.m. Additional information on the endorsement process will be sent out later this week I hope this email will assist you in your preparations.
